1. Bring attention to points of interest with a walkway
You may have a stunning sitting area, garden, or fire pit in your yard, but if the only way to get to it is to trample on the lawn, you’re doing your layout a disservice. Deter the makeshift path of dead grass, and bring attention to all these points of interest on your property with an attractive walkway. Whether it’s made of stepping stones, crushed stone or mulch, this landscaping tip will connect the entire setup of your property fabulously, for greater appeal.
2. Break it up with a big rock
One of the easiest ways to break up the view of a monotonous yard, while also adding a statement, is to place in a giant rock or two. The landscape pro secret in this case is to make sure that the boulder is complementary in color, size, and shape to other landscape elements, and attractive as well, which will ensure that its appearance is purposeful and harmonizing.
3. Add appeal with a berm
A berm is a raised bank or flat strip of land that can work wonders for your curb appeal. It will add some style and life to a plain yard, too. Berms are especially beneficial when added on the corner of lots, as they take advantage of an often-unused area. Top it off with a flower garden, and the added color and texture will enhance the aesthetics of your property immensely.
4. Curved is always better
Whether it’s a garden, walkway or berm, landscaping pros always suggest that curved edges are better. This adds instant appeal and character that makes your lot stand out from all the rest. Since curved edging is permanent, as well, this attractive feature will enhance your landscape all year long.
5. Bring light to walkways and focal points
Your attractive landscaping deserves to be seen at all hours of the day, and by illuminating walkways and focal points, you allow that to happen. Adding lights to your landscaping serves many roles, from providing safety, to showcasing points of interest, to enhancing the beauty of your property. To do this like a pro, pick up some solar-powered lights and illuminate your yard after hours right away, at a low cost.
